How to Configure Remote Access: A Simple Step-by-Step Guide
Remote access allows users to connect to a computer, server, or network from another location as if they were physically present. People search for how to configure remote access because they need a practical, reliable way to work remotely, manage systems, or provide technical support without being on-site. The process is not complicated, but it must be done correctly to avoid security risks and connectivity problems. This guide explains each step clearly so remote access can be configured safely and effectively.
Understanding Remote Access and Its Use Cases
Remote access is a method that enables control or monitoring of a system over a network connection. It is commonly used by IT administrators, remote workers, and support teams to access files, applications, or system settings from a distance. Common technologies include Remote Desktop Protocol (RDP), Virtual Private Networks (VPNs), SSH, and cloud-based remote tools.
Before learning how to configure remote access, it is important to understand why it is needed. Businesses rely on it to support distributed teams and reduce operational delays. Individuals use it to access personal computers, manage servers, or troubleshoot devices remotely. Each use case may require a slightly different configuration approach.
Preparing Systems and Networks Before Configuration
Preparation is critical before enabling any remote access feature. Start by confirming that the target system supports remote connections and is fully updated with the latest operating system patches. Updates reduce vulnerabilities that could be exploited once remote access is enabled.
Network readiness is equally important. Ensure the system has a stable internet connection and a known IP address or hostname. Firewalls and routers should be reviewed to confirm they allow the required ports while blocking unnecessary traffic. This step prevents connection failures and minimizes exposure to external threats.
User accounts must also be reviewed. Only authorized users should have remote access privileges, and each account should use strong, unique passwords. This foundational setup reduces risks before moving into actual configuration steps.
How to Configure Remote Access on Common Operating Systems
The exact steps for how to configure remote access vary by operating system, but the principles remain consistent. On Windows systems, Remote Desktop is the most common option. It can be enabled through system settings by allowing remote connections and selecting which users are permitted to log in remotely.
On macOS, remote access is usually handled through Screen Sharing or Remote Management. These features are enabled in system preferences, where user permissions and access levels can be defined. Linux systems typically rely on SSH for command-line access or VNC for graphical sessions, both of which require service installation and configuration files.
After enabling the feature, testing is essential. Attempt a connection from another device on the same network before trying an external connection. This step isolates local configuration issues before adding network complexity.
Configuring Secure Network Access and Port Forwarding
Security should never be an afterthought when configuring remote access. Exposing a system directly to the internet without protection is a common mistake. Using a VPN is one of the most effective ways to secure remote connections because it creates an encrypted tunnel between the user and the network.
If a VPN is not used, port forwarding may be required on the router. This involves directing specific external ports to the internal IP address of the target system. Only required ports should be opened, and default ports should be changed when possible to reduce automated attacks.

Firewall rules should be carefully defined. Allow access only from trusted IP ranges when feasible, and log all remote access attempts. These measures help detect suspicious activity and maintain system integrity.
User Authentication and Access Control Best Practices
Strong authentication is a core part of any remote access setup. Password-based authentication alone is often insufficient, especially for systems exposed to the internet. Implementing multi-factor authentication (MFA) adds a second verification layer and significantly improves security.
Access control should follow the principle of least privilege. Users should only have the permissions necessary to perform their tasks, nothing more. Administrative access should be limited to a small number of trusted accounts.
Session management is another important factor. Configure automatic session timeouts and idle disconnections to reduce the risk of unattended open sessions. These controls prevent unauthorized access if a remote device is left unattended.
Testing, Monitoring, and Maintaining Remote Access
Once remote access is configured, ongoing maintenance is required. Initial testing should include different scenarios, such as connecting from external networks and using various devices. This ensures reliability under real-world conditions.
Monitoring tools should be enabled to track login attempts, session durations, and failed connections. Logs provide valuable insight into usage patterns and potential security incidents. Regular review of these logs is part of responsible system management.
Maintenance also includes periodic updates and access reviews. Remove users who no longer require remote access and rotate credentials on a regular schedule. This ongoing process keeps the remote access environment secure and functional.
Conclusion
Understanding how to configure remote access is essential for modern work, system administration, and technical support. By preparing systems properly, configuring access carefully, and enforcing strong security controls, remote connections can be both reliable and safe. A structured approach reduces downtime, minimizes risk, and ensures long-term usability of remote access solutions.
FAQ
Q: What is the safest way to configure remote access? A: Using a VPN combined with strong authentication provides the highest level of security for remote access. Q: Do I need to open ports on my router for remote access? A: Port forwarding is required if accessing systems directly, but it can often be avoided by using a VPN. Q: Can remote access slow down system performance? A: Performance impact is usually minimal, but it depends on network speed, encryption, and system resources. Q: Is remote access suitable for personal use? A: Yes, it is commonly used for accessing personal files or managing home systems securely. Q: How often should remote access settings be reviewed? A: Access permissions and security settings should be reviewed regularly, ideally every few months.
